对像素的渐变效果[Java]

时间:2017-04-14 02:09:12

标签: java graphics gradient

我怎么能将渐变应用到这样的东西?刚刚得到一个纯色。

for (int i = 0; i < screen.pixels.length; i++)
    screen.pixels[i] = 0xff0000;

1 个答案:

答案 0 :(得分:0)

通过获取十六进制代码的RGB值,循环获得渐变的矩形的大小,并在两个r,g和b值之间进行插值来解决此问题。

       Category     sum
1        Airfare  428.40
2         Dining   13.42
3  Entertainment   10.00
4     Healthcare 1525.00
5       Internet   26.94
6        Lodging    9.88
7    Merchandise  306.12
8 Other Services  421.70
9    Phone/Cable   22.08